Le Torre**** is situated in via Sardegna
in the centre of Arborea. The town boasts
a rich historical past and today offers
visitors culture, typical flavours and
traditions. Arborea sprang up following
the reclamation of the Campidano plain
and gets its name from the most famous
of the four regions (Giudicati) which
existed in Sardinia between the XI and
XV centuries. The beautiful town centre
presents a mixture of Liberty and Neo-Gothic
architecture and the local economy is
based on agricultural produce from the
surrounding fertile land. It is famous
for its strawberries, water melons, cheese
and rice. Arborea is ideally situated
for all the important places of interest
in the area, which abounds in culture
and history.

Oristano, the chief
town of the Medieval Giudicato of
Arborea, attracts of visitors because
of its beautiful architecture and
local traditions. The town is famous
for the exciting horse-riding event
known as the Sartiglia,
which takes place during Carnival
time. The archaeological
site of Tharros is also
not far away. It was founded in
Phoenician-Punic times and was later
expanded during the Roman era, is
one of the most important sites
in the Mediterranean. Other places:
the Sinis peninsular and the protected
marine area of Sinis Mal
di Ventre, the Cabras
marshlands and the town
of Santa Giusta,
built on the remains of the Roman
city of Othoca.
